Output 589ef304d74421bc1579085a7ed1ff4e4d8bd0c58f08de3201c7e3b586960724:1
- value
- 17683438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db48bbd8fb65f16a410cbaeaf736647a96fc2ebb OP_EQUAL
- address
- MTtdM5AfWEtT1P3rRaotCharbLRHkzE8Zr
- transaction
- 589ef304d74421bc1579085a7ed1ff4e4d8bd0c58f08de3201c7e3b586960724
- spent
- true